This long-lost director’s cut – a time capsule that resonates today – features Amiri Baraka, Dick Gregory, Jesse Jackson, Coretta Scott King, Bobby Seale, Betty Shabazz and other activists at the 1972 National Black Political Convention in Gary, Indiana. Narrated by Sidney Poitier & Harry Belafonte. Restored with support from the Hollywood Foreign Press Association.
